Olympus M.ZUIKO DIGITAL 40-150mm 1:4-5.6 ED R MSC - Review / Test Report

The construction of the lens is basic as to be expected from an affordable, consumer-grade lens. The lens body is made entirely of plastic down to the lens mount which is also why the lens is extremely light-weight at just 190g.

Olympus 40-150mm f/4-5.6 ED M.Zuiko Digital review by Ocean

small and handy but I am not used to the extreme cheap-construction Level without lens hood and every few month I got dust between the lenses Optics are good - the first half year, with a bit to much CA. With weekly practice it's getting worse. The price is to high, it's just a cheap-starter Zoom.

to expensive for the quality; CA; no metall; cheap plastics

Olympus 40-150mm f/4-5.6 ED M.Zuiko Digital

Just got this a couple of days ago. It's great for portraits, and for nearer objects at mid focal range, it's terrifically sharp. However, zoomed out on distant objects, I found it didn't resolve very well.

cheap; light; at some focal lengths very sharp; due to length can have nice blur at times; although sometimes rough

feels flimsy; zooms out ridiculously long; AF (on E-PM1) useless for moving objects
